State Approach

Kansas courts recognize the enforceability of forum selection clauses, similar to the federal standard established in Atlantic Marine. The analysis focuses on the reasonableness of the clause in the context of Kansas law, ensuring it does not contravene public policy or statutory prohibitions.

Comparison to Federal Law

While Kansas law aligns closely with federal law regarding forum selection clauses, there tends to be a more rigorous scrutiny of public policy issues. Kansas courts may investigate the fairness of the stipulated forum more cautiously than federal courts.
